Army, Police review security in Poonch

Jammu: Indian Army, along with police held a joint security review meeting on Monday in Poonch district of Jammu and Kashmir.

Defence spokesman said Army along with Police and other intelligence agencies reviewed the security situation in Poonch.

“A collaborative discussion was carried out during the meeting to arrive at a robust posture based on the assessments of the participating agencies,” he added.
